A Beasty Brew

“Beauty blood.” Grissella Ravenclaw squinted at the potion’s blurred label, shrugged her crooked shoulders, and poured. The cauldron burbled with a green, stinky goo. She wrinkled her warty nose and swallowed the goop down anyway. She’d be the queen of the Goblin’s Halloween ball.

Her stomach gurgled.

She shivered and burped.

Then her nose bulged into a toothsome snout, and her ears perked up. Gray fur covered her skin, ending in a fluffy tail… and itchy FLEAS! Her paws on the shelf, she read the label with wolf-sharp eyes. “Noooo,” she howled. “I wanted beauty blood. Not beasty blood! Aahhroooo…”

One of Those Dopey Days

Some days my own dopiness astounds me. Today was one of those days.

I had a day of writing planned…no interruptions…no other duties…a Saturday of pure 100% BLISS.

However, I decided to clean up my wordpress media library which was overloaded with images.

Never having done this before, I looked up instructions on the handy internet. Easy enough. Go here, click there, wave the magic cursor over the images and select “Delete Permanently.”

“Well,” I said to my myself, “most of these images I’ll never use again. I might as well just delete them.”

Ta Da! That felt good. 50 images gone…breathing easy. I’m getting really good at this!

Then I open my website. My background is GONE. The images for all my posts are GONE. A little lightbulb blinks on in my head. Crap!

Guess what I did all day…
